diff --git a/package.json b/package.json index bae4071cc..64c8c5459 100644 --- a/package.json +++ b/package.json @@ -20,16 +20,16 @@ "dependencies": { "@astrojs/sitemap": "^1.1.0", "@astrojs/tailwind": "^3.0.1", - "astro": "^2.0.15", - "astro-compress": "^1.1.34", + "astro": "^2.0.17", + "astro-compress": "^1.1.35", "node-html-parser": "^6.1.5", - "npm-check-updates": "^16.7.9", + "npm-check-updates": "^16.7.10", "rehype-external-links": "^2.0.1", "roadmap-renderer": "^1.0.4", "tailwindcss": "^3.2.7" }, "devDependencies": { - "@playwright/test": "^1.31.1", + "@playwright/test": "^1.31.2", "@tailwindcss/typography": "^0.5.9", "gh-pages": "^5.0.0", "js-yaml": "^4.1.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 5ebf7e208..93ce82419 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-3,15 +3,15 @@ lockfileVersion: 5.4 specifiers: '@astrojs/sitemap': ^1.1.0 '@astrojs/tailwind': ^3.0.1 - '@playwright/test': ^1.31.1 + '@playwright/test': ^1.31.2 '@tailwindcss/typography': ^0.5.9 - astro: ^2.0.15 - astro-compress: ^1.1.34 + astro: ^2.0.17 + astro-compress: ^1.1.35 gh-pages: ^5.0.0 js-yaml: ^4.1.0 markdown-it: ^13.0.1 node-html-parser: ^6.1.5 - npm-check-updates: ^16.7.9 + npm-check-updates: ^16.7.10 prettier: ^2.8.4 prettier-plugin-astro: ^0.8.0 rehype-external-links: ^2.0.1 @@ -20,17 +20,17 @@ specifiers: dependencies: '@astrojs/sitemap': 1.1.0 - '@astrojs/tailwind': 3.0.1_enl5tymeuxlslzmmdrwlr7zkvy - astro: 2.0.15 - astro-compress: 1.1.34 + '@astrojs/tailwind': 3.0.1_o7rlocdsudmdrstqcqbafrcodq + astro: 2.0.17 + astro-compress: 1.1.35 node-html-parser: 6.1.5 - npm-check-updates: 16.7.9 + npm-check-updates: 16.7.10 rehype-external-links: 2.0.1 roadmap-renderer: 1.0.4 tailwindcss: 3.2.7 devDependencies: - '@playwright/test': 1.31.1 + '@playwright/test': 1.31.2 '@tailwindcss/typography': 0.5.9_tailwindcss@3.2.7 gh-pages: 5.0.0 js-yaml: 4.1.0 @@ -54,6 +54,11 @@ packages: /@astrojs/compiler/1.1.0: resolution: {integrity: sha512-C4kTwirys+HafufMqaxCbML2wqkGaXJM+5AekXh/v1IIOnMIdcEON9GBYsG6qa8aAmLhZ58aUZGPhzcA3Dx7Uw==} + dev: true + + /@astrojs/compiler/1.2.0: + resolution: {integrity: sha512-O8yPCyuq+PU9Fjht2tIW6WzSWiq8qDF1e8uAX2x+SOGFzKqOznp52UlDG2mSf+ekf0Z3R34sb64O7SgX+asTxg==} + dev: false /@astrojs/language-server/0.28.3: resolution: {integrity: sha512-fPovAX/X46eE2w03jNRMpQ7W9m2mAvNt4Ay65lD9wl1Z5vIQYxlg7Enp9qP225muTr4jSVB5QiLumFJmZMAaVA==} @@ -73,13 +78,13 @@ packages: vscode-uri: 3.0.7 dev: false - /@astrojs/markdown-remark/2.0.1_astro@2.0.15: + /@astrojs/markdown-remark/2.0.1_astro@2.0.17: resolution: {integrity: sha512-xQF1rXGJN18m+zZucwRRtmNehuhPMMhZhi6HWKrtpEAKnHSPk8lqf1GXgKH7/Sypglu8ivdECZ+EGs6kOYVasQ==} peerDependencies: astro: ^2.0.2 dependencies: '@astrojs/prism': 2.0.0 - astro: 2.0.15 + astro: 2.0.17 github-slugger: 1.5.0 import-meta-resolve: 2.2.0 rehype-raw: 6.1.1 @@ -110,14 +115,14 @@ packages: zod: 3.20.2 dev: false - /@astrojs/tailwind/3.0.1_enl5tymeuxlslzmmdrwlr7zkvy: + /@astrojs/tailwind/3.0.1_o7rlocdsudmdrstqcqbafrcodq: resolution: {integrity: sha512-QSYh/xmz454j1yZU9rjw2J24PpH7j3h2ClesqMaAniOtcuL8RfP7KYCnCrk01xvjwqqO+QBpZNDD/SUhHNtFFg==} peerDependencies: astro: ^2.0.4 tailwindcss: ^3.0.24 dependencies: '@proload/core': 0.3.3 - astro: 2.0.15 + astro: 2.0.17 autoprefixer: 10.4.13_postcss@8.4.20 postcss: 8.4.20 postcss-load-config: 4.0.1_postcss@8.4.20 @@ -126,8 +131,8 @@ packages: - ts-node dev: false - /@astrojs/telemetry/2.0.0: - resolution: {integrity: sha512-RnWojVMIsql3GGWDP5pNWmhmBQVkCpxGNZ8yPr2cbmUqsUYGSvErhqfkLfro9j2/STi5UDmSpNgjPkQmXpgnKw==} + /@astrojs/telemetry/2.0.1: + resolution: {integrity: sha512-68BLBb9CcvQMkWHE6h6VTgm5g6agm3+xm8eb3cdkmX9nP1LSQ/fiD49Jb1qAgCtWcY8yQJiWQQXwcdyStD+VoA==} engines: {node: '>=16.12.0'} dependencies: ci-info: 3.7.0 @@ -136,16 +141,16 @@ packages: dset: 3.1.2 is-docker: 3.0.0 is-wsl: 2.2.0 - undici: 5.18.0 + undici: 5.20.0 which-pm-runs: 1.1.0 transitivePeerDependencies: - supports-color dev: false - /@astrojs/webapi/2.0.1: - resolution: {integrity: sha512-aOOHa86W5Ux77A3dS91YrVlSxtBSJsVK4UhvcXHY0gAl0ZrOStSKSBO45gZ6tFi2AiHu3bzpMtZjwrPHtl+cyg==} + /@astrojs/webapi/2.0.2: + resolution: {integrity: sha512-uSNtxLuvCWOcwy/DdIy30ocIcIUedEZpyhn1MHW3XuZ3PZHg4PMej3EP38Ns6uKgDKqMyEdscca9bMLuf4cO/w==} dependencies: - undici: 5.18.0 + undici: 5.20.0 dev: false /@babel/code-frame/7.18.6: @@ -750,13 +755,13 @@ packages: tiny-glob: 0.2.9 tslib: 2.4.1 - /@playwright/test/1.31.1: - resolution: {integrity: sha512-IsytVZ+0QLDh1Hj83XatGp/GsI1CDJWbyDaBGbainsh0p2zC7F4toUocqowmjS6sQff2NGT3D9WbDj/3K2CJiA==} + /@playwright/test/1.31.2: + resolution: {integrity: sha512-BYVutxDI4JeZKV1+ups6dt5WiqKhjBtIYowyZIJ3kBDmJgsuPKsqqKNIMFbUePLSCmp2cZu+BDL427RcNKTRYw==} engines: {node: '>=14'} hasBin: true dependencies: '@types/node': 17.0.45 - playwright-core: 1.31.1 + playwright-core: 1.31.2 optionalDependencies: fsevents: 2.3.2 dev: true @@ -1082,30 +1087,30 @@ packages: engines: {node: '>=0.10.0'} dev: true - /astro-compress/1.1.34: - resolution: {integrity: sha512-To7O9z+vhllvP/qSWszJBjVYZgf8g3omkUq8IOroPjElqur1W+bPTq01RNO/aLp9bQ6YqBpwa2j+cSwa/j3FxQ==} + /astro-compress/1.1.35: + resolution: {integrity: sha512-K6BK+iMbejXeUS1eAjoQhRh4geEutFrGkgCkeTAthf1XeRzPrWvtNPA7RjJBXWR8aNJtjryxyW02z3pE+4RNow==} dependencies: '@types/csso': 5.0.0 '@types/html-minifier-terser': 7.0.0 '@types/sharp': 0.31.1 csso: 5.0.5 - files-pipeline: 0.0.4 + files-pipe: 0.0.1 html-minifier-terser: 7.1.0 sharp: 0.31.3 svgo: 3.0.2 terser: 5.16.5 dev: false - /astro/2.0.15: - resolution: {integrity: sha512-CUJNrcdgcSjASValRNEesTgXSefgQ8Z9GHrZXckmTivatoBlVkYb8G8tmk7dgRt6JF+bwfOsA6cGdv7+G7hCbA==} + /astro/2.0.17: + resolution: {integrity: sha512-K/SAoe4Tfhg4XhOu1mFOp9qiC/m8YuBmL3//WAA+mcPTlg9A21nlXH/jmsfbizQdZn/AyoPrkTWQm1pnU05OsQ==} engines: {node: '>=16.12.0', npm: '>=6.14.0'} hasBin: true dependencies: - '@astrojs/compiler': 1.1.0 + '@astrojs/compiler': 1.2.0 '@astrojs/language-server': 0.28.3 - '@astrojs/markdown-remark': 2.0.1_astro@2.0.15 - '@astrojs/telemetry': 2.0.0 - '@astrojs/webapi': 2.0.1 + '@astrojs/markdown-remark': 2.0.1_astro@2.0.17 + '@astrojs/telemetry': 2.0.1 + '@astrojs/webapi': 2.0.2 '@babel/core': 7.20.7 '@babel/generator': 7.20.7 '@babel/parser': 7.20.7 @@ -1120,7 +1125,7 @@ packages: common-ancestor-path: 1.0.1 cookie: 0.5.0 debug: 4.3.4 - deepmerge-ts: 4.2.2 + deepmerge-ts: 4.3.0 devalue: 4.2.0 diff: 5.1.0 es-module-lexer: 1.1.0 @@ -1700,11 +1705,6 @@ packages: engines: {node: '>=4.0.0'} dev: false - /deepmerge-ts/4.2.2: - resolution: {integrity: sha512-Ka3Kb21tiWjvQvS9U+1Dx+aqFAHsdTnMdYptLTmC2VAmDFMugWMY1e15aTODstipmCun8iNuqeSfcx6rsUUk0Q==} - engines: {node: '>=12.4.0'} - dev: false - /deepmerge-ts/4.3.0: resolution: {integrity: sha512-if3ZYdkD2dClhnXR5reKtG98cwyaRT1NeugQoAPTTfsOpV9kqyeiBF9Qa5RHjemb3KzD5ulqygv6ED3t5j9eJw==} engines: {node: '>=12.4.0'} @@ -2021,8 +2021,8 @@ packages: trim-repeated: 1.0.0 dev: true - /files-pipeline/0.0.4: - resolution: {integrity: sha512-eHbXa8YGUui/qGnxES+SwwQVpQpi4xz2VR1VrJz1HFflnRWo8+zCQCseRqDAzMinH1B6iI9ckVWpFgoWnTH9nA==} + /files-pipe/0.0.1: + resolution: {integrity: sha512-+U75QMGwmNi6S3cLJPCXtCWCUP3QTKCf6zwtW+7A+OS06PDbiX6MOPI3KE6XZZKLl0UYdiB3rimyFeqZDUdh1g==} dependencies: deepmerge-ts: 4.3.0 fast-glob: 3.2.12 @@ -3409,6 +3409,13 @@ packages: brace-expansion: 2.0.1 dev: false + /minimatch/7.4.2: + resolution: {integrity: sha512-xy4q7wou3vUoC9k1xGTXc+awNdGaGVHtFUaey8tiX4H1QRc04DZ/rmDFwNm2EBsuYEhAZ6SgMmYf3InGY6OauA==} + engines: {node: '>=10'} + dependencies: + brace-expansion: 2.0.1 + dev: false + /minimist/1.2.7: resolution: {integrity: sha512-bzfL1YUZsP41gmu/qjrEk0Q6i2ix/cVeAhbCbqH9u3zYutS1cLg00qhrD0M2MVdCcx4Sc0UpP2eBWo9rotpq6g==} @@ -3618,8 +3625,8 @@ packages: npm-normalize-package-bin: 3.0.0 dev: false - /npm-check-updates/16.7.9: - resolution: {integrity: sha512-2/T9PB0W1uABB1N11jdnPauqNLXMhPUyC0DBeeGlUktcGl/412f40iqFsnNGCqIAag/C37SjLNiW2/yuD7Salw==} + /npm-check-updates/16.7.10: + resolution: {integrity: sha512-sLDgYD8ebkH9Jd6mPIq7UDGLr3DAxkHl6ZuJrEF4rauLv6DqHBxtnF16MHUPN+/eBt5QbH4GL/+nxfSAFm3TfQ==} engines: {node: '>=14.14'} hasBin: true dependencies: @@ -3636,9 +3643,9 @@ packages: json-parse-helpfulerror: 1.0.3 jsonlines: 0.1.1 lodash: 4.17.21 - minimatch: 6.2.0 + minimatch: 7.4.2 p-map: 4.0.0 - pacote: 15.1.0 + pacote: 15.1.1 parse-github-url: 1.0.2 progress: 2.0.3 prompts-ncu: 2.5.1 @@ -3839,8 +3846,8 @@ packages: semver: 7.3.8 dev: false - /pacote/15.1.0: - resolution: {integrity: sha512-FFcjtIl+BQNfeliSm7MZz5cpdohvUV1yjGnqgVM4UnVF7JslRY0ImXAygdaCDV0jjUADEWu4y5xsDV8brtrTLg==} + /pacote/15.1.1: + resolution: {integrity: sha512-eeqEe77QrA6auZxNHIp+1TzHQ0HBKf5V6c8zcaYZ134EJe1lCi+fjXATkNiEEfbG+e50nu02GLvUtmZcGOYabQ==} engines: {node: ^14.17.0 || ^16.13.0 || >=18.0.0} hasBin: true dependencies: @@ -3962,8 +3969,8 @@ packages: dependencies: find-up: 4.1.0 - /playwright-core/1.31.1: - resolution: {integrity: sha512-JTyX4kV3/LXsvpHkLzL2I36aCdml4zeE35x+G5aPc4bkLsiRiQshU5lWeVpHFAuC8xAcbI6FDcw/8z3q2xtJSQ==} + /playwright-core/1.31.2: + resolution: {integrity: sha512-a1dFgCNQw4vCsG7bnojZjDnPewZcw7tZUNFN0ZkcLYKj+mPmXvg4MpaaKZ5SgqPsOmqIf2YsVRkgqiRDxD+fDQ==} engines: {node: '>=14'} hasBin: true dev: true @@ -5034,8 +5041,8 @@ packages: resolution: {integrity: sha512-8Y75pvTYkLJW2hWQHXxoqRgV7qb9B+9vFEtidML+7koHUFapnVJAZ6cKs+Qjz5Aw3aZWHMC6u0wJE3At+nSGwA==} dev: true - /undici/5.18.0: - resolution: {integrity: sha512-1iVwbhonhFytNdg0P4PqyIAXbdlVZVebtPDvuM36m66mRw4OGrCm2MYynJv/UENFLdP13J1nPVQzVE2zTs1OeA==} + /undici/5.20.0: + resolution: {integrity: sha512-J3j60dYzuo6Eevbawwp1sdg16k5Tf768bxYK4TUJRH7cBM4kFCbf3mOnM/0E3vQYXvpxITbbWmBafaDbxLDz3g==} engines: {node: '>=12.18'} dependencies: busboy: 1.6.0